Have you ever read a passage of Scripture and the timing felt, well, like only God could have known exactly what was happening in your life at that moment… and then brought His Word directly to you to remind you of His sovereignty?
That is how it felt for me when I read Psalm 2:8 a couple of weeks ago.
In three separate conversations, in just a matter of days, we were asked to consider opportunities in Nigeria, Ethiopia, and South Africa. In what felt like moments later, Psalm 2:8 jumped off the page of a document as it crossed my desk. It felt like a word directly from the Father … and was filled with the reminder of His anointing on the shepherd leadership message.
Once again, we stand in awe of the Father and how He works in our lives.

May October find you in awe of the Good Shepherd as He provides all you need, protects you as He knows is best in every situation, and showers His presence upon you … in ways that surprise you!

What's Next

Serve the Lord with fear, and rejoice with trembling.
Psalm 2:11

  • October – Continued content development, a shepherd leadership webinar presentation to HSLDA (Home School Legal Defense Association) parents and students, preparation for a workshop with the African Centre for Theological Studies (ACTS) in November in Lagos, Nigeria, and continued fund development for the hiring of a Vice President of Partner Relationship and Content Development.
  • November – Christian Leadership Alliance (CLA) Women’s CEO Retreat at Ridgecrest Retreat Center in Black Mountain, North Carolina, visits to prayer and resourcing partners in that area, and the facilitation of a workshop and facilitator training for approximately 100 multiplying pastors for ACTS in Lagos, Nigeria, adding a new partner and another country to the shepherd leadership multiplication movement.
  • December – Celebration of our Lord’s birth and content development.
  • January/February 2023 – The co-facilitation of a Leadership from the Shepherd’s Perspective workshop in Addas Ababa, Ethiopia, for the YFCI Ethiopia team and volunteers.
  • March 2023 – The facilitation of a shepherd leadership breakout session for the CLA Outcomes Conference in Chicago, Illinois.
  • April 2023 – Potential facilitation of a workshop for a variety of southern African countries for YFCI.
